Before we begin, let’s clarify why you might consider replacing tile edging with melamine edge banding. Tile edging, while attractive in some applications, can be prone to chipping, cracking, and discoloration over time. It’s also significantly more labor-intensive to install and repair. Melamine edge banding, on the other hand, offers superior resistance to scratches, moisture, and wear and tear. The wide range of colors and finishes available from our factory allows you to perfectly match existing furniture or create a completely new look. Furthermore, the installation process is much simpler and requires fewer specialized tools.
Tools and Materials You Will Need:

* Iron: A standard household iron is sufficient. Avoid using steam settings.
* Scraper: A sharp scraper, ideally a specialized edge banding scraper, is essential for removing excess banding.
* Utility Knife: A sharp utility knife is needed for precise trimming.
* Sandpaper: Fine-grit sandpaper (around 220-grit) is used for smoothing any rough edges.
* Clamps (Optional): Clamps can help secure the banding in place during the curing process, especially for longer edges.
* Measuring Tape: For accurate measurements of the edge banding needed.
* Pencil: To mark the edges for cutting.
* Safety Glasses: Always protect your eyes.
* Gloves (Optional): Protect your hands from potential cuts.
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ing Tile Edging with Melamine Edge Banding:
1. Preparation:
Begin by carefully removing the existing tile edging. This might require a chisel, hammer, or other specialized tools depending on the type of adhesive used. Thoroughly clean the surface of any remaining adhesive residue, ensuring a clean and level surface for the new edge banding. Lightly sand the edges to improve adhesion.
2. Measuring and Cutting:
Measure the length of the edge requiring banding. Add a few extra centimeters to account for trimming. Cut the melamine edge banding to the required length using a sharp utility knife or scissors. Ensure the cut is clean and straight.
3. Applying the Edge Banding:
Place the cut edge banding onto the edge of the furniture, ensuring it's aligned correctly. Use a medium-heat setting on your iron (no steam!). Gently press the iron over the edge banding, moving slowly and evenly along the length. The heat will activate the adhesive on the back of the banding, bonding it securely to the substrate. The application process should be a careful yet decisive ironing motion to ensure a proper bond without burning the material.
4. Trimming Excess Banding:
Once the banding is firmly attached, use a sharp scraper to carefully remove any excess banding that extends beyond the edge. Work slowly and deliberately to avoid damaging the underlying surface. For curved edges, a more flexible scraper is recommended.
5. Smoothing and Finishing:
Use fine-grit sandpaper to smooth any rough edges or imperfections. This will ensure a perfectly smooth and professional finish. Gently sand along the edge, working in the direction of the grain to avoid creating scratches.
6. Final Inspection:
Carefully inspect the finished edge for any imperfections. If necessary, repeat steps 4 and 5 to achieve a perfect result. Once you're satisfied, your tile edging replacement is complete!
Tips for Success:
* Practice on a scrap piece of material before working on your actual project. This helps you get accustomed to the pressure and temperature needed for proper application.
* Maintain consistent iron pressure and speed to avoid uneven adhesion or burning.
* Use a sharp blade for precise cuts to minimize the need for extensive sanding.
